About Sughtar Khan (425)

Sughtar Khan (425) is a rural settlement in Nurpur, Kangra, Himachal Pradesh. It has a population of 168 in about 32 households (avg size: 5.25). Approximate literacy: 83.33%.

Population of Sughtar Khan (425)

Population (Total)168
Male89
Female79
Children (0–6 years)13
Households32
Literate persons140
Illiterate persons28
Total workers93
Sex ratio (♀ per 1000 ♂)888
Literacy (approx.)83.33%
SC population15
ST population0
